The way I read your question, you might be wanting to use Drill to query Elasticsearch, or are you might be trying to index Drill query results with Elasticsearch.

If the first, this project looks cool: https://github.com/Anchormen/sql4es <https://github.com/Anchormen/sql4es>

You could use Drill + JDBC plugin + sql4es JDBC driver to query ES. I have not tried this myself.

If the second, you could CTAS to JSON <http://drill.apache.org/docs/create-table-as-ctas-command/>, then ingest the JSON into ES using your favorite method - e.g., logstash or something like that.
